About this House

BOM due to buyer financing. This is your chance to own a classic New England 3-family home just minutes from everything that makes Exeter so special. Just half a mile from vibrant downtown, Phillips Exeter Academy, and the scenic Squamscott River, this well-maintained property offers unbeatable convenience. Whether you're looking for a place to live while generating rental income, investing in a sought-after location, or seeking a multi-generational living option, this home offers the flexibility and value you've been waiting for. Each of the three 1-bedroom, 1-bath units is filled with potential. The first-floor apartment includes laundry access in the basement, while the two upstairs units are bright and welcoming. The property is serviced by town water and sewer, oil heat, and electric hot water. Updates include energy-efficient thermopane windows, a rebuilt side porch, and a roof that has been replaced in sections over the past eight years. Outside, the spacious backyard is perfect for small gatherings or a bit of gardening. The detached 2-car garage, off-street parking, and attached shed/workshop offer additional storage and potential—whether you dream of a home office, hobby space, or fitness area. A walk-up attic opens the door to future expansion ideas. Don’t miss this rare opportunity to invest in a property with both character and income potential. 32 Union Street, Exeter, NH 03833 is a 3 bedroom, 3 bathroom, 2,342 sqft multi-family built in 1900. It last sold for $700,000 on Oct 24, 2025 (3% below the $725,000 asking price). It is currently off market. The Trulia Estimate is $718,600, with a rent estimate of $2,965/month.
